研究目的
To describe the design, development, and testing of an AR system for aerospace and ground vehicles that meets stringent accuracy and robustness requirements, focusing on the optical/inertial hybrid tracking system and novel solutions to challenges with optics, algorithms, synchronization, and alignment.
研究成果
The paper presents a novel AR system for use in moving vehicles, meeting all performance targets through thorough simulations, car testing, and flight test programs. The auto-harmonization algorithm and covariance-based analysis of line-of-sight registration error provide new approaches to error budgeting for AR systems.
研究不足
The system's performance is dependent on the accuracy of the hybrid tracking system and the alignment and calibration of all subsystems. Challenges include achieving low latency, high tracking accuracy, and precise alignment to avoid mis-registration and 'swim'.
